A bombshell indictment against Trump raises questions about political motivations and the integrity of the justice system. The discussion critiques the legal charges of conspiracy and obstruction related to January 6, arguing they lack substantial evidence. There's skepticism over media coverage and potential bias in judicial proceedings. The implications for the 2024 election and free speech are analyzed, highlighting concerns of double standards in political prosecutions and how they affect public discourse.

Political Indictment

  • Jack Smith's indictment against Donald Trump is political, stretching legal definitions.
  • Crimes require specific elements, and disliking Trump's actions doesn't make them criminal.

Backup Case

  • The classified documents case in Florida poses a greater legal threat to Trump.
  • The D.C. case seems like a backup, relying on a Trump-hostile jury.

Non-Criminal Lies

  • Trump's alleged lies, while potentially harmful, don't automatically constitute a crime.
  • The indictment lacks a specific charge like incitement, suggesting a political motivation.
